The Ministry of Tourism, Arts, and Culture has announced the launch of the National Heritage Photo Competition 2025, a move aimed at exhibiting the rich cultural heritage of Ghana’s people through photography.
All individuals between the ages of 15 – 20 across the 16 regions of Ghana are eligible to take part in this competition.
The Honourable Minister of Tourism, Culture, and Creative Arts, Abla Dzifa Gomashie, stated that the goal of the competition is to provide an avenue for young people to showcase their creativity and skills while promoting the rich culture and heritage of Ghana.
“We are not only promoting our rich cultural heritage, but providing opportunities for young Ghanaians to showcase their creativity,” she remarked.
Speaking on eligibility and requirements, she explained that entries for the competition can include photographs of cultural products and heritage sites. She mentioned, however, that participants must not be above 25 years.
This initiative is organized in partnership with the United Nations Educational, Scientific, and Cultural Organization (UNESCO).
The National Heritage Photo Competition 2025 is also supported by a pool of organizations, which include: the Ghana Tourism Authority, National Folklore Board, National Commission for Culture, Bureau of Ghana Languages, National Theatre of Ghana, National Film Authority, and Ghana Tourism Development Authority.
